I first get an idea of what the client likes, we do sketch's and discuss what they have in mind, I see what gems or diamonds they have to work with.
In this project the diamonds came from older jewelry given to the couple from her Grandmother. I remove the diamonds from the older setting and carefully measure them for size and carat weight. The millimeter measurements are the most important to me at this time. as well as finger sizes, which are also carefully measured.
In the past these types of design would be hand carved from a block of jewelers carving wax.This is still possible, however these days I also use the latest in Cad Cam technology to create a wax model of the design. You can see the detail on the side of the shank would be impossible to hand carve into the wax pattern. This also produces a photo realistic rendering of the design for the client to approve before making the wax pattern.This wax pattern is produce by taking the cad model to a CNC4 axis mill which will carve out the model exactly as shown in the rendering.
In this case they also see images of the wax model and approve the design once more before it is cast in white gold. In the images you can see the flask which holds the wax pattern is burnout or pretty much disintegrated in order to make a void which is filled with molten metal , this casting is done in 14k white gold. From this point the casting is hand finished and all the diamond are hand set. And then delivered to the happy couple.
